抄録: To preserve natural lake shore environment along Lake Biwa, the beach processes should beinvestigated. Haginohama is one of the beautiful sandy beaches in the west side of the lake. Inthis paper, beach processes of Haginohama are studied in terms of coastal engineering to clarifythe present situation of the beach and to predict beach changes.Wave hindcasting was carried out for a period of 32 years between 1950 and 1981 to find long-term wave action on Haginohama beach. The Gumbel extremal distribution is employed to esti-mate the most probable wave heights and their return periods. Characteristics of beach sedimentare considered, and predominant directions of littoral sand drift are found along the beach. Nume-rical calcualtion was made to estimate the predominant directions of littoral sand drift in terms oflongshore wave energy flux for every five years of the period. This agrees with the predominantdirections estimated by the characteristics of beach sediment. A one-dimensional analysis of beachchange was employed to predict beach changes in several conditons of sediment sources and shorestructures. From the view point of long-term beach change, there exists a deposition area by thecentral part of Haginohama beach, but the effective waves to the beach was caused by the typhoonswhich passed through near the lake.
